基于分裂电容的超级电容器储能系统研究

摘    要:针对超级电容器在电力系统的应用,综合分析储能控制器的典型拓扑结构及其特点,采用双向DC/DC变换器作为超级电容器组的升压稳压环节,以解决超级电容器端电压随储能状态大范围变化的问题,提高其的容量利用率;并将两组双向DC/DC变换器串联,以控制逆变环节直流母线的分裂电容电压.同时,引入带重复控制的双闭环控制方法,以提高超级...

关 键 词:超级电容器  不平衡负载  非线性负载  重复控制

Research on Super Capacitor Energy Storage System Based on Split Capacitor

Abstract:Some typical topologies and the corresponding characteristics of energy storage control converters used in power system are comprehensively analyzed.According to the application of supercapacitor in power system,bi-direc-tional DC/DC converter as voltage Boost and stable regulator is used to stabilize the widely fluctuating voltage of su-percapacitor bank with its state of charge.As a result,the capacity utilization of supercapacitor is improved.Two bi-directional DC/DC converters are series connected to ma...
Keywords:supercapacitor  unbalance load  nonlinear load  repetitive control
